Day 1 – Arusha to Tarangire ecosystem for elephant and predator tracking
Your 5 Days Signature Northern Circuit Safari Journey begins with morning pick-up from Arusha or Moshi and a scenic drive to Tarangire National Park, a key dry-season wildlife refuge and elephant stronghold. Ecological studies coordinated by the United States Geological Survey and habitat protection programs supported by Conservation International highlight the importance of Tarangire’s river systems and woodland corridors for large mammals.
You enjoy an extended afternoon game drive focusing on elephant family behaviour, lion movement along seasonal wildlife routes and large herds of plains game. Your guide positions the vehicle carefully to respect wildlife viewing standards promoted by international conservation organisations. Overnight at a comfortable safari lodge or tented camp close to the park.

Day 4 – Ngorongoro Conservation Area and crater wildlife viewing
Your 5 Days Signature Northern Circuit Safari Journey proceeds to the Ngorongoro Conservation Area, a unique multiple-use protected landscape recognised by UNESCO for its natural and cultural value. Conservation planning and ecosystem assessments supported by the International Union for Conservation of Nature and biodiversity governance research by IPBES show why this area is central to long-term wildlife protection.
You descend into the crater for a concentrated game drive focusing on lion prides, large buffalo herds and black rhinoceros monitoring zones supported by conservation partners such as the Wildlife Conservation Society. Overnight on the crater rim or in the nearby highlands.
Day 5 – Lake Manyara ecosystem and return to Arusha
The final day of your 5 Days Signature Northern Circuit Safari Journey visits the Lake Manyara ecosystem, a biodiversity hotspot for primates and birdlife. Avian research and wetland conservation programs led by BirdLife International and habitat studies supported by the National Geographic Society highlight the ecological importance of this groundwater forest and rift valley lake system.
After a relaxed game drive, you return to Arusha in the late afternoon, marking the end of your safari.
